About this subject
A fiber optic transceiver is a device that combines a transmitter and receiver into a single module, converting electrical signals to optical and vice versa. These components are essential in fiber optic communication networks, enabling high-speed data transmission over long distances with low loss. They are used in telecommunications infrastructure, data centers, enterprise networks, and internet service providers.
Transceivers follow standardized form factors such as SFP, SFP+, QSFP, and others, allowing hot-plugging and easy replacement. Each type supports different data rates, from 1 Gbps to 400 Gbps or more, depending on the technology. The choice of transceiver depends on distance, fiber type (single-mode or multi-mode), and required speed. For instance, single-mode fiber transceivers are used for long distances, while multi-mode is common for short distances within data centers.
With growing bandwidth demand, optical transceivers have evolved to support techniques like wavelength-division multiplexing (WDM), increasing transmission capacity without new fiber. Manufacturing these devices involves precise components such as lasers, photodetectors, and control circuits, being fundamental to the modern global internet.
Frequently Asked Questions
What is a fiber optic transceiver?
It is a device that converts electrical signals to optical and vice versa, used in fiber optic networks to transmit data.
What are the most common types?
Common form factors include SFP, SFP+, QSFP, QSFP28, and CFP, each with different speeds and reaches.
How to choose the correct transceiver?
Consider network speed, distance, fiber type (single-mode or multi-mode), and compatibility with the equipment.
